The EASDefault Web application

In EAServer 5.1, all Web pages that are not part of a Web application are added automatically to the EASDefault Web application. You configure the properties for EASDefault the same as you do for other Web applications.

Initially, the context path for EASDefault is “/”, and the WEB-INF directory is created under $JAGUAR/html. When users access http://host:port/, EAServer invokes the welcome page of the Web application whose context path is “/”.
